[Regression][Windows] Gameobjects disappear from Scene View when moving viewpoint away from them
Steps to repro:
1. Open attached project and 't1' scene;
2. In the Scene View scroll out to move it away from terrain.
Expected result:
Terrain is visible when scrolling out.
Actual result:
Terrain disappears from Scene view. See attached video.
Regression introduced in Unity 2017.2.0b4.
Notes:
- Reproducible in 2017.3a2, 2017.2.0b5, 2017.2.0b4;
- Not reproducible in 2017.2.0b3, 2017.1.0p2, 5.6.0p2;
- Reproducible only in Windows 10; not reproducible on OSX 10.12.5;
- Reproducible for any gameobject, though the bug is more visible for huge objects;
- The bug is only valid in Scene view; it doesn't affect actual gameobject rendering in Game view.
